Limit of an Integral Involving Iterated Composite Rational Functions

Let f(x)=x/((1+x^n)^(1/n)), x ∈ R-{-1}, n ∈ N, n>2. If f^n(x)=(fofof ….. upto n times)(x), then Lim_(n → ∞) integral from 0 to 1 of x^(n-2)(f^n(x)) d x is equal to
